SITUATION:  No 24, West Walk is situated almost at the end of a quiet private cul-de-sac road on the western fringe of West Bay which forms part of the Jurassic Coastline.  In West Bay there is a good range of local amenities, including shops, hotels, a picturesque harbour which provides good boating facilities and, on East Cliff, there is an 18-hole golf course.  In addition, there are some fine coastal walks in the immediate vicinity along the cliff tops.

The market town of Bridport lies about 1.5 miles due north with its comprehensive range of shops and professional offices.  The area is one of outstanding natural beauty and there are some delightful walks along the coastal path many of which are through land which is the responsibility of the National Trust and now has World Heritage status.

Dorchester, the County Town of Dorset, lies about 15 miles to the east and here there is a main line rail service to London, Waterloo.

THE PROPERTY:  No 24, West Walk comprises a beautifully maintained, modernised detached 3 bedroom bungalow featuring part-rendered and reconstituted stone elevations under a tiled, lined and insulated roof.  The bungalow originally dates from the mid-1970's and, in recent years, has been professionally updated to a high standard and benefits from far-reaching countryside views to Bridport in the distance.

Features include a modern well fitted kitchen, a uPVC double-glazed conservatory with access from the dining room, cavity wall insulation, gas-fired central heating, uPVC double-glazed windows and doors and is generally offered in excellent decorative order throughout.

The gardens are a particular feature enclosed for privacy and seclusion beautifully landscaped with an abundance of shrubs and a vegetable garden together with a timber chalet/studio, potting shed, greenhouse, tool shed.  There is an attached garage and off-road parking.
